Losing multiple teeth can affect eating, speech, and confidence, especially if you struggle with loose dentures. Dental implants offer a stable, long lasting solution for replacing multiple missing teeth and large gaps, with alternatives including dentures and bridges.

The consequences of missing teeth extend far beyond mere aesthetics. Opting for dental implants to replace multiple missing teeth is vital for various reasons:

1. Restoring Functionality: Missing teeth can severely impair your ability to chew and speak properly. Dental implants function just like natural teeth, restoring your ability to enjoy your favourite foods and articulate speech with confidence.

2. Preserving Jawbone Density: The roots of natural teeth stimulate the jawbone, helping to maintain its density. When teeth are lost, the jawbone starts to deteriorate, potentially leading to a sagging facial appearance. Dental implants mimic the function of natural tooth roots, preventing bone loss and maintaining facial structure.

3. Enhancing Oral Health: Gaps left by missing teeth can become a breeding ground for bacteria, leading to gum disease and further tooth loss. Dental implants fill these spaces, preventing the buildup of harmful bacteria and promoting better oral hygiene.

4. Boosting Self Confidence: Missing teeth can impact your self esteem, making you hesitant to smile or engage in social situations. Dental implants provide a natural looking and confident smile, boosting your self assurance and overall well being.

Unlike bridges, dental implants don’t require altering neighboring teeth. A titanium implant is placed into the jaw under local anaesthetic to replace a tooth root. Implants take 3–6 months to heal and integrate with the bone, with temporary teeth usually provided during this period.

Traditional dentures, though helpful in restoring some functionality, can often become loose and uncomfortable over time. The revolutionary technique of stabilizing loose dentures with dental implants, also known as implant supported dentures or overdentures, offers significant advantages:

1. Enhanced Stability: By anchoring dentures to dental implants, the prosthetics are held firmly in place, preventing slippage and allowing you to eat, speak, and laugh without worrying about embarrassment or discomfort.

2. Improved Chewing Efficiency: Loose dentures can make it difficult to chew and enjoy certain foods. With dental implant support, you can regain the ability to eat a diverse range of foods, promoting better nutrition and overall health.

3. No More Adhesives: Traditional dentures often require messy adhesives to keep them in place. Implant supported dentures eliminate the need for adhesives, simplifying your daily dental care routine.

4. Long Term Durability: Dental implants are designed to be a long term solution, and with proper care, they can last a lifetime. This provides cost effectiveness and peace of mind compared to other temporary solutions.

The dental implant process is generally carried out in several stages:

1. Assessment and Treatment Planning: Your dentist will conduct a comprehensive examination, including X-rays and scans, to assess your oral health and determine the most suitable treatment plan.

2. Implant Placement: Dental implants are surgically placed into the jawbone, where they integrate and fuse with the bone over several months. During this healing period, temporary dentures may be provided.

3. Abutment Placement: Once the implants have fully integrated, abutments are attached to the implants. These act as connectors between the implants and the dentures.

4. Denture Attachment: The customized dentures are securely attached to the abutments, creating a stable and natural looking smile.

5. Follow-up Care: Regular check ups with your dentist are essential to monitor the success of the dental implant procedure and maintain your oral health.
